June 17, 2011

The inaugural east coast Campout Festival at Misty Mountain Camp Resort is bringing plenty of musical talent, thousands of concert goers and an economic boost to the western Albemarle County town of Crozet.

“We have all kinds of music: Futurebirds from Athens, Georgia, Those Darlins from Tennessee, Sons of Bill from right here in Crozet,” event organizer, Velena Vego said of the festival lineup.

The two-day, weekend series (June 17-18), which will showcase the region's best music, art and food, is one of the first of its kind to make a stop in Crozet. And area music lovers are taking notice. The festival has already booked the entire campground, with some guests arriving as early as Tuesday.

“We've already sold about 700 advanced tickets and we're hoping for about 1,100 each day,” Vego said. While weekend camping passes are sold out, Saturday event tickets are still on sale for $27.

Organizers believe the venue offers the best of both worlds: beautiful views of the Blue Ridge Mountains coupled with WiFi access and a swimming pool at Misty Mountain. Plus, some of the best food vendors in Central Virginia.

“It's the area's best food. We got Crozet Pizza, La Cocina del Sol, The Backyard and Fardowners Restaurant,” said Ian Solla-Yates.

They're just a few of the many ingredients to a highly anticipated outdoor music festival.
